function initPage() 
	{ 
		$("form#namesearch").submit(function(){
		loader("searchresults", 208);
		$.get("social_search_friends.php",{name: $("#name").val()}, function(data) {
			$("#searchresults").empty();
			$("#searchresults").append(data);
		});
		return false;
		});

		$("form#groupsearch").submit(function(){
		loader("groupresults", 208);
		$.get("social_search_groups.php",{name: $("#gname").val()}, function(data) {
			$("#groupresults").empty();
			$("#groupresults").append(data);
		});
		return false;
		});


		$("form#wall_post").submit(function(){
		$.post("social_wall_post.php",{message: $("#wall_message").val(), user_uid:$("#wall_user_uid").val(), group_uid:$("#wall_group_uid").val()}, function(data) {
			$("#addtowall").empty();
			$("#addtowall").append(data);
		});
		return false;
		});

	}

function onlinenow(id)
	{
		loader(id, 208);
		$.get("social_search_friends_online.php",{}, function(data) {
			$("#"+id).empty();
			$("#"+id).append(data);
		});
	}
	
function loader(div_id, size)
	{
		$("#"+div_id).empty();
		$("#"+div_id).append("<center><img src='images/loader.gif' width="+size+" /></center>");
	}

function reloadfriends()
	{
		loader("friends", 208);
		$.get("social_loadfriends.php",{}, function(data) {
     		$("#friends").empty();
     		$("#friends").append(data);
		});
	}

function reloadgroups()
	{
		loader("groups", 208);
		$.get("social_loadgroups.php",{}, function(data) {
     		$("#groups").empty();
     		$("#groups").append(data);
		});
	}
	
function addfriend(uid, shortname, fullname, imagesrc)
	{
		if(shortname.length>0)
			{
				$.get("social_friend_add.php",{uid: uid}, function(data) {
     				$("#friend"+uid).remove();
     				$("#friends").append("<div class=social_miniprofile id=friend"+uid+"><a onclick='javascript:loadprofile("+uid+")' title='"+fullname+"'><input type=image src='"+imagesrc+"' width=60 height=80 border=0 /></a><span class=small>"+shortname+"</span></div>");
				});
			}
		else
			{
				$.get("social_friend_add.php",{uid: uid}, function(data) {
     				$("#addfriend"+uid).remove();
				});
			
			}
	}
	
function removepost(uid)
	{
		$.get("social_wall_remove.php",{uid: uid}, function(data) {
			$("#wall"+uid).remove();
		});
	}

function removefriend(uid)
	{
		$.get("social_friend_remove.php",{uid: uid}, function(data) {
			$("#friend"+uid).remove();
			$("#bigprofile").empty();
		});
	}

function loadprofile(uid)
	{
		loader("bigprofile",208);
		$.get("social_profile.php",{uid: uid}, function(data) {
			$("#bigprofile").empty();
			$("#bigprofile").append(data);
			social_menu(1);
			initPage();
		});
	}
	
function invite(user_uid, group_uid)
	{
		$.get("social_group_invite.php",{user_uid: user_uid, group_uid: group_uid}, function(data) {
			$("#gfriend"+user_uid).remove();
		});
	}

function joingroup(group_uid)
	{
		$.get("social_group_join.php",{group_uid: group_uid}, function(data) {
			$("#groupstatus").empty();
			$("#groupstatus").append(data);
			reloadgroups();
			loadgroup(group_uid);
		});
	}

function leavegroup(group_uid)
	{
		$.get("social_group_leave.php",{group_uid: group_uid}, function(data) {
			$("#groupstatus").empty();
			$("#groupstatus").append(data);
			reloadgroups();
			loadgroup(group_uid);
		});
	}

function loadgroup(uid)
	{
		loader("bigprofile",208);
		$.get("social_group.php",{uid: uid}, function(data) {
			$("#bigprofile").empty();
			$("#bigprofile").append(data);
			social_menu(1);
			initPage();
		});
	}
	
function social_menu(uid)
	{
		$("#media").empty();
		$("#social_menu").children().hide();
		$("#social_menu"+uid).show();
	}	

function loadflv(file)
	{
		$("#media").empty();
		var requiredMajorVersion = 9;
		var requiredMinorVersion = 0;
		var requiredRevision = 0;
		var hasReqestedVersion = DetectFlashVer(requiredMajorVersion, requiredMinorVersion, requiredRevision);
		if(hasReqestedVersion)
			{
				var so = new SWFObject("file/flvplayer.swf?file="+file+"&autostart=true", "mymovie", "304", "224", "7", "#FFFFFF");
				so.write("media");
			}
	}
	
function loadmp3(file)
	{
		$("#media").empty();
	    $("#media").html("<embed src='"+file+"' autostart=true>");
	}

function loadpic(file)
	{
		$("#media").empty();
	    $("#media").html("<img src='"+file+"' width='310' alt='"+file+"' border='0' />");
	}